aboutsummaryrefslogtreecommitdiff
path: root/sys/fs/cuse
diff options
context:
space:
mode:
authorHans Petter Selasky <hselasky@FreeBSD.org>2016-09-23 07:41:23 +0000
committerHans Petter Selasky <hselasky@FreeBSD.org>2016-09-23 07:41:23 +0000
commit19f1b6fb7b49633dea04fcad3882d116ed0c79d6 (patch)
tree4195266e9bdb2f899e82c93e4aa72dcfc5d2681b /sys/fs/cuse
parentdeffc4a02658a77de8f650f8dfa2177dd0d13b70 (diff)
downloadsrc-19f1b6fb7b49633dea04fcad3882d116ed0c79d6.tar.gz
src-19f1b6fb7b49633dea04fcad3882d116ed0c79d6.zip
Prevent cuse4bsd.ko and cuse.ko from loading at the same time by
declaring support for the cuse4bsd interface in cuse.ko. Found by: Sergey V. Dyatko <sergey.dyatko@gmail.com> MFC after: 1 week
Notes
Notes: svn path=/head/; revision=306228
Diffstat (limited to 'sys/fs/cuse')
-rw-r--r--sys/fs/cuse/cuse.c6
1 files changed, 6 insertions, 0 deletions
diff --git a/sys/fs/cuse/cuse.c b/sys/fs/cuse/cuse.c
index 6035f8d59d53..33d36c586e2b 100644
--- a/sys/fs/cuse/cuse.c
+++ b/sys/fs/cuse/cuse.c
@@ -63,6 +63,12 @@
MODULE_VERSION(cuse, 1);
+/*
+ * Prevent cuse4bsd.ko and cuse.ko from loading at the same time by
+ * declaring support for the cuse4bsd interface in cuse.ko:
+ */
+MODULE_VERSION(cuse4bsd, 1);
+
#define NBUSY ((uint8_t *)1)
#ifdef FEATURE